Hello
That picture was originally posted by my fellow South African BMW#4. It was from a letter to dealers showing the changes from March 2005, which will be MY06 in the USA.
Outside the USA we get a stowage space, the USA gets extra knee protection instead to comply with safety regulations ( this has happened with a number of models, example E39 had a very different dash for europe and USA)
